Comparing Nutrients in 500 calories Frozen Chopped BroccoliVS Black Currants
Weight per 500 calories
Frozen Chopped Broccoli
1923g
Black Currants
794g
Raw European Black Currants have 2.4 times more energy per unit of mass than Frozen Chopped Broccoli, Unprepared, which is low in comparison to other foods. Frozen Chopped Broccoli having very low energy density.

Lets compare vitamin content per 500 calories of Frozen Chopped Broccoli vs Black Currants:
500 calories of Frozen Chopped Broccoli have 10.5 times more Vitamin A, 2.6 times more Vitamin B1, 4.7 times more Vitamin B2, 3.8 times more Vitamin B3, 1.7 times more Vitamin B5, 4.8 times more Vitamin B6 and 3 times more Vitamin E than Black Currants.
While 500 kcal of Raw European Black Currants contain 1.3 times more Vitamin C than Frozen Chopped Broccoli, Unprepared.
Both Frozen Chopped Broccoli, Unprepared as well as Raw European Black Currants have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 in 500 calories.
Comparing minerals per 500 calories for Frozen Chopped Broccoli vs Black Currants:
500 calories of Frozen Chopped Broccoli have 2.5 times more Calcium, 1.3 times more Iron, 1.8 times more Magnesium, 2.8 times more Manganese, 2.1 times more Phosphorus, 1.6 times more Potassium, 29.1 times more Sodium, 4.3 times more Zinc and 2.7 times more Water than Black Currants.
Both Frozen Chopped Broccoli and Black Currants contain similar levels of Copper per 500 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 500 calories:
500 calories of Frozen Chopped Broccoli have 3.5 times more Omega 3 and 4.9 times more Protein than Black Currants.
While 500 kcal of Raw European Black Currants contain 1.3 times more Carbohydrate than Frozen Chopped Broccoli, Unprepared.
Both Frozen Chopped Broccoli and Black Currants offer comparable quantities of Energy per 500 calories.
Both Frozen Chopped Broccoli, Unprepared as well as Raw European Black Currants prov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6 in 500 calories.
